What does “Hundo P” mean?
The phrase "Hundo P" means '100 percent' or 'absolutely.' When someone uses "Hundo P", they are expressing complete certainty or agreement with a statement or idea, similar to saying 'without a doubt' or 'without question.'
How is the expression used in real life?
Example
I'm hundo p sure I left my keys here.
Example
He's hundo p committed to the cause.
Example
Her answer was hundo p correct.

What is the origin of the phrase?
"Hundo P" is a slang expression that originated in online and text messaging culture. It is a shortened form of '100 percent' and is commonly used to emphasize complete certainty or agreement.
Can the phrase be used on its own?
While "hundo p" is often used within a sentence, it can also be used on its own to convey complete certainty or agreement. For example, if someone asks if you're sure about something, you can simply respond with "Hundo P!" to indicate your absolute certainty.
Is the phrase offensive?
"Hundo P" is not offensive in itself. It's a slang term used to express certainty or agreement.
Audience for the phrase
"Hundo P" is commonly used by younger generations, particularly millennials and Gen Z. People who are familiar with internet slang and online communication are more likely to use and understand it.
Is the phrase specific to an accent or country?
"Hundo P" is not specific to any particular accent or region. It is used across English-speaking regions and has gained popularity through online platforms and social media.
